OnX Hunt Elite Features: Nationwide Coverage and More

Elite isn’t just “Premium Plus.” It’s a jump to an entirely different level of hunting intelligence and planning. Key features include:

  • Nationwide + Canada Coverage – One subscription unlocks all 50 states and Canada, perfect for DIY out-of-state hunts.
  • Exclusive map tools – Elite members have access to Terrain X – Powerful 3D tools for finding hidden benches, saddles, and game travel corridors. Trail Cam Integration, Route builder and more
  • Expert Resources – Elite members have exclusive access to courses and master classes from top hunters.
  • Application Season Tools – Track key application deadlines, draw odds, and hunting season dates in every state with access to three industry-leading tools: onX Hunt Research Tools, Huntin’ Fool, and HuntReminder.
  • Elite Pro Deals – Exclusive gear discounts from top hunting brands.
  • LiDAR : Next-Level Scouting: One of the biggest OnX Hunt updates in years – LiDAR. This technology delivers pinpoint-level elevation, giving hunters an unmatched advantage in e-scouting. You’ll be able to identify hidden benches, see subtle terrain features, and analyze cover with more accuracy than ever before.

Field Tips from Elite Users: Must-Have vs. Nice-to-Have

We spoke with several hunters who put Elite to the test, and here’s what they rely on the most:

Must-Have Features:

  • Multi-State Layers – lets you stack the exact overlays you need. From burns and water holes to migration routes, layers lets you dial in every hunt with precision.
  • Car Play integration. – Being able to see your full onX Hunt app on your truck’s dash is awesome for finding public land for South Dakota pheasants.
  • Trail Cam integration and analysis – Mark your trail cam locations and upload your photos for detailed analysis and tips.
  • Draw Odds & Deadlines – Saves hours of research each spring.
  • Elite Pro Deals – Many hunters say the gear discounts alone cover the cost of the membership.

Nice-to-Have Features:

  • Full Canada maps, historical imagery, and some of the more specialized layers — valuable if you hunt Canada.

$100 a Year for All 50 States: A High-Value Hunting Investment

From my perspective, the real magic of OnX Hunt Elite isn’t just the features — it’s the sheer amount of utility you get for a very reasonable annual fee. At $100 a year, you’re getting comprehensive coverage for all 50 states (plus Canada), cutting-edge scouting tools like Terrain X and LiDAR, and access to Pro Deals that can easily pay for the membership with discounts on gear you were going to buy anyway.
For any hunter who travels, it’s hard to find another $100 investment that delivers this much year-round value.
